PCOS, commonly known as polycystic ovarian syndrome, is a condition with multiple epigenetic components and a number of symptoms to look out for, including irregular menstruation and excessive hair growth. Learn how to treat PCOS naturally with diet and lifestyle changes in this Doc Talk with Levels Research Design Lead Dr. Azure Grant and Cissy Hu.
